    Default Problem with linking two pages

    Dear all,

    I can't link a page http://www.shopbymaja.com/narudžba.html with my other pages. My site is www.shopbymaja.com. Can you please help me. I've successfully managed to link all other pages together and for this one I've used the same way and it doesn't work. Please help!!
    Tks

    Default Re: Problem with linking two pages

    I would try taking the z and making it a regular z - I don't believe using that character is allowed in addresses.

    Kacie...

    In BV.. you make your page, then go to FILE at the top left corner and SAVE AS .. name your page.

    Now go to file AGAIN, and lower down is publish. This is how you get your page onto the server with bv. You will need to know the server number that came with your account... and the path.. if its the main domain it will be /public_html

    Disregard any thoughts of FTP. This wont work with your BV properly.
